  • At King's Cross Church, we are Sent on Mission. This means we believe we are called to make and multiply disciples, and we subscribe to the idea that it's not if we're called, but to whom and to where. This June had 5 Sundays which meant we were able to turn that last Sunday of the month into Formation Sunday, exploring one of the many spiritual disciplines that helps to form our faith. Listen to this teaching to learn some practical ways you can live life on mission exactly where you are!

    Matthew 28:1-7

    1 Now after the Sabbath, toward the dawn of the first day of the week, Mary Magdalene and the other Mary went to see the tomb. 2 And behold, there was a great earthquake, for an angel of the Lord descended from heaven and came and rolled back the stone and sat on it. 3 His appearance was like lightning, and his clothing white as snow. 4 And for fear of him the guards trembled and became like dead men. 5 But the angel said to the women, “Do not be afraid, for I know that you seek Jesus who was crucified. 6 He is not here, for he has risen, as he said. Come, see the place where he lay. 7 Then go quickly and tell his disciples that he has risen from the dead, and behold, he is going before you to Galilee; there you will see him. See, I have told you.”
